Overview of the KitchenAid Go Cordless Food Chopper

The KitchenAid Go Cordless Food Chopper is a versatile kitchen appliance designed for convenience and portability. Priced at $89.99, it offers the ability to operate without being tethered to an outlet, thanks to its rechargeable battery. This chopper boasts a sales rank of 51,770, indicating a moderate level of popularity among consumers.

This food chopper stands out with a unique feature: its cordless design enables users to move freely around the kitchen. The 12v MAX battery, which is sold separately, provides up to 25 minutes of continuous runtime. KitchenAid has designed the appliance for ease of use, featuring a simple assembly process and an all-in-one storage solution for blades and discs. With two speed settings, users can easily adjust the chopping speed to achieve the desired texture, making it a flexible option for various culinary tasks.

Overview of the OROZEE Deluxe Food Processor

The OROZEE Deluxe Food Processor is a budget-friendly option priced at $19.99, making it significantly more affordable than the KitchenAid model. With a sales rank of 41,745, it demonstrates a better market performance compared to its competitor, suggesting that it resonates well with cost-conscious shoppers.

This food processor features a powerful 300W motor paired with stainless steel blades, designed for professional use. It excels in versatility, enabling users to chop, blend, mix, mince, and puree a variety of ingredients. The OROZEE model emphasizes safety and ease of cleaning, with a design that ensures the blades stop rotating once the motor is disengaged. This focus on functionality makes it a practical tool for everyday cooking needs.

Performance Comparison

When it comes to performance, the KitchenAid Go Cordless Food Chopper offers a unique advantage with its cordless operation, allowing for greater mobility in the kitchen. Its runtime of 25 minutes on a single charge is suitable for quick tasks, but users must keep in mind that the battery is sold separately, adding to the initial cost.

In contrast, the OROZEE Deluxe Food Processor provides a more powerful 300W motor, which can handle larger or tougher ingredients with ease. This processor's ability to chop vegetables and meat in a matter of seconds can significantly cut down on preparation time. Although it requires a power outlet, its operational efficiency might appeal more to those who need a robust solution for regular cooking tasks.

Safety Features

Safety is a crucial consideration when using kitchen appliances. The KitchenAid model includes several design elements that enhance safety, such as a battery life indicator and a robust construction to prevent accidents while chopping.

The OROZEE Deluxe Food Processor takes safety a step further with its thermal protection device, which prevents overheating, and safety switches that halt the motor if the button is released. These features are particularly beneficial for those who may be new to using food processors or are concerned about kitchen safety. Overall, while both appliances provide safety features, the OROZEE model appears to have more comprehensive safeguards in place.
